Verdict

The Gigabyte Z390 Aorus Xtreme Waterforce is a flagship E-ATX motherboard designed for 8th and 9th Gen Intel processors, distinguished by its massive all-in-one monoblock that liquid-cools the CPU, 16-phase digital VRM, and Z390 chipset. It boasts elite connectivity including dual Thunderbolt 3 ports, Aquantia 10GbE LAN, and Intel 802.11ac Wi-Fi, alongside a high-fidelity ESS SABRE 9018K2M DAC for premium audio. Key pros include exceptional thermal management for extreme overclocking, a robust power delivery system, and extensive RGB customization via RGB Fusion 2.0. However, its primary drawbacks are the extremely high price point, large E-ATX footprint that limits case compatibility, and the necessity of a custom liquid cooling loop for operation.

What customers like about GIGABYTE Z390 AORUS Xtreme Waterforce?

  • Exceptional thermal performance with an AIO monoblock covering the CPU, VRM, and chipset
  • Robust 16-phase digital VRM design highly capable of extreme overclocking
  • High-end connectivity features including dual Thunderbolt 3 ports and 10GbE LAN
  • Advanced leak detection sensors that automatically shut down the system if coolant is detected
  • Extensive and customizable RGB lighting through the included RGB Fan Commander
  • Excellent onboard audio quality utilizing an ESS SABRE DAC

What customers dislike about GIGABYTE Z390 AORUS Xtreme Waterforce?

  • Extremely high price point that is difficult for most users to justify
  • Installation can be frustrating due to an 'unbearably short' RGB cable on the monoblock
  • Requires a custom water cooling loop, making it unusable with standard air or AIO coolers
  • Large E-ATX form factor may not fit in standard mid-tower cases
  • Lack of a PLX chip limits the number of available PCIe lanes for multi-GPU setups
  • Memory overclocking configuration can be finicky compared to some competitors
